What will you do in our team?
There are many challenges ahead of you in the NOC team. You will be responsible for monitoring the LINK Mobility platforms deployed throughout Europe, including troubleshooting, fixing issues and incident management. You will also have the opportunity to prove yourself in many areas, such as monitoring & alert optimization, reporting, developing and improving internal procedures and documentation. You will be working in an international environment on a daily basis cooperating with Operations, DevOps, Customer Support, as well the telecom operators across Europe.
Your main tasks will include:
Monitor and supervise production messaging platforms and infrastructure across Europe
Independently troubleshoot incidents (L2/L3) and identify root causes
Take end‑to‑end ownership of incidents: coordination, escalation, communication and follow‑up
Actively participate in Incident, Problem and Change Management (ITIL)
Handle premium / SLA customers, including technical communication
Cooperate closely with DevOps, Engineering, Customer Support and telecom operators
Improve monitoring, alerting, dashboards and operational tooling
Create and maintain clear, high‑quality operational documentation
Support knowledge sharing and onboarding within the NOC team
Required Skills & Knowledge
3+ years of experience in NOC / Monitoring / Technical Operations / Support (L2+)
Solid Linux experience (troubleshooting, logs, CLI, production systems)
Good understanding of networking fundamentals (TCP/IP, LAN/WAN)
Hands‑on experience with monitoring tools (e.g. Zabbix, Grafana, LogicMonitor)
Proven experience working in 24/7 environments with real incident responsibility
Practical knowledge of ITIL processes (Incident, Problem, Change)
Ability to work independently and make decisions during incidents
Very good English and Polish (spoken and written)
It is to your advantage if you have some experience in the following technologies and tools:
Virtualization technologies (e.g., VMware or similar)
Additional monitoring platforms (Grafana, Nagios, Prometheus)
Elastic stack
Understanding of telecommunications operator processes, including MVNO operations and messaging/SMS systems
